§ 16-38-12. Penalty for violations.

Every person violating any provision of this chapter shall be fined not exceeding fifty dollars ($50.00) or be imprisoned not exceeding thirty (30) days unless provided in this section; provided, that the penalty shall not apply to §§ 16-38-4 to 16-38-6.

Legislative History

G.L. 1909, ch. 73, § 12; P.L. 1922, ch. 2234, § 16; G.L. 1923, ch. 77, § 12; G.L. 1938, ch. 198, § 11; G.L. 1956, § 16-38-12.
